Beatrice H.
Davenport
Oct 19, 1924 — Aug 11, 2021
Mrs. Beatrice H. Davenport age 96, formerly of McMinnville, TN, died Wednesday, August 11, 2021, at Cape Canaveral Hospital in Florida. Funeral services were conducted August 18, 2021, at Gath Baptist Church. Ray Gilder officiated. Interment followed at Gath Cemetery. There will be no visitation at the funeral home. The family is also requesting for everyone to wear facial masks and practice social distancing regardless of vaccination status due to the spike of Covid-19 Delta Variant.
Beatrice was an owner and operator of One-Hour Martinizing Dry Cleaning in Athens, TN. She also worked at Graber's Department Store and Batesville Casket Company. She volunteered at River Park Hospital in the Rehab Department and with Meals-on-Wheels. Bea was a member of Gath Baptist Church, attended First Christian Church of Titusville for over 9 years, loved traveling, and playing Rummy Cube with her Senior Group. She was preceded in death by her parents Robert Harrison and Flora Lucinda Kelly Hale, husband Harding C. Davenport, and brother Grady Hale.
Beatrice is survived by her daughter Linda Jones and her husband Jack of Titusville, her son Rev. Michael Cantrell and his wife Brenda of Milan, Indiana, 5 grandchildren Cyndi Vazquez, husband Mark, Robb Jones, wife Carrie, Tim Cantrell, wife Kathy, Shawn Cantrell, wife Lori, Kim Leja, husband Greg, 17 great-grandchildren Madison (Wyatt), Mason, Mallory, Malachi, Max, Brandon, Briana, Alexis, Matthew, Isabella, Lauren, Jonathan, Peyton, Nathan, Natalie, Jaymeson, and Aubrey, one great-great grandson Trevor, her sister Lucy Snyder of Alexandria, Tennessee, step children Dorothy Foster of Mesquite, TX and Faye Braxton of McMinnville, and several step grandchildren and step great-grandchildren.
Memorial contributions may be made to the Gath Cemetery Fund or to the Gideon's International Memorial Bible Program.
